Most music aficionados credit Marvin Gaye, a popular American singer, songwriter, and record producer in the 1960s, with developing the “Motown Sound.” (“Motown Sound” was a phrase coined by the Motown record label. The phrase was trademarked and formed the basis of a new genre of music; in fact, the genre was referred to as “Motown” because the Motown record label produced the majority of songs that created the new genre). The Motown Sound is characterized by tambourines, which accented the backbeat, as well as electric bass-guitar lines, call and response singing style, which originated from gospel music, and charted horn sections. It is common belief that music was first incorporated into films in the early 1900’s, to help drown out the noises the projector made during viewing. In the early days, this musical coverage was provided by an in-house musician; then it later evolved into entire orchestras. In both accompaniments, the musician or musicians would be provided with cue sheets that served as a story map or guide to played along with the film while it was being shown. In almost all instances, the music consisted of recognizable pieces by famous composers. As the technology of projectors and filming equipment advanced, the need for this musical distraction dwindled. Funk music, a style that found its beginning in the late 60’s, is a style remembered and recognised for its influence and innovation throughout the music scene. Funk has multitude characteristics distinctive to its genre, and these characteristics helped aid the evolution of many memorable genres of music, from disco in the late 70’s to the popular music we listen to today but most prominently, in the emersion of hip-hop during 90’s.

I will conduct 32 semi-structured interviews with a goal of speaking to16 black Chicagoans for each case study. For the House music study, I will focus on two groups to gather a larger understanding of how House music and The Warehouse operated as a safe space for black gay and/or queer males. Secondly, I will investigate The Warehouse as a space in which black heterosexual and homosexual communities collectively formed the larger sociospatial and cultural identity connected to House music that spread globally. I will interview eight black, male Chicagoans that identity as queer and/or gay who are between the ages of 45-65 years of age. This is crucial because my human subjects would have to be old enough to have attended The Warehouse, which existed between 1979-1984 or old enough to have engaged with house music between 1980-1990, when it was at its peak.
